ホームページ >バックエンド開発 >PHPチュートリアル >PHP環境構築チュートリアル - 詳細なグラフィックとテキストの説明
この記事では、PHP を使用した環境の構築方法を画像とテキストを組み合わせて詳しく紹介します。また、興味のある方は参考にしてください。
関連おすすめ:
PHPとは何かの概要
PHP(Hypertext Preprocessor、ハイパーテキストプリプロセッサ)、サーバーですクロスプラットフォームの HTML 埋め込みスクリプト言語であり、C 言語、Java 言語、Perl 言語の特徴を組み合わせた、特に Web 開発に適したオープンソースの多目的スクリプト言語です。
PHP は B/S (ブラウザ/サーバー、ブラウザ/サーバー) アーキテクチャであり、3 層構造です。サーバーの起動後は、クライアント ソフトウェアを使用せずにブラウザだけでサーバーにアクセスできるため、グラフィカル ユーザー インターフェイスが維持されるだけでなく、アプリケーションのメンテナンスの量も大幅に削減されます。
PHP言語の利点
PHPはフリーソフトウェアとオープンソースコードから生まれ、Webアプリケーション開発にPHPを使用すると次のような利点があります。
高いセキュリティ: PHP はオープンソース ソフトウェアであり、プログラム コードが Apache でコンパイルされる方法により、セキュリティ設定がより柔軟になります。 PHP はセキュリティ特性を認識しています。
クロスプラットフォーム機能: PHP は、ほぼすべてのオペレーティング システム プラットフォームをサポートし、Apache や IIS などの複数の Web サーバーをサポートします。
幅広いデータベースをサポート: MySQL、Access、SQL Server、Oracle、DB2 など、主流および非主流のさまざまなデータベースを操作できます。その中で、現在最も優れているのは PHP と MySQL です。組み合わせ、およびそれらの組み合わせをクロスプラットフォームで実行できます。
学習が簡単: PHPは、豊富な組み込み関数、シンプルな構文、簡単な記述を備えたHTML言語、主にスクリプト言語に埋め込まれているため、読者が簡単に学習して習得できます。
速い実行速度: はシステムリソースの消費が少なく、コードの実行速度が速いです。
無料: 人気のエンタープライズアプリケーション LAMP プラットフォームでは、Linux、Apache、MySQL、および PHP はすべて無料のソフトウェアであり、このオープンソースで無料のフレームワーク構造により、Web サイト運営者は多額の費用を節約できます。
テンプレート: プログラムロジックとユーザーインターフェイスの分離を実現します。
オブジェクト指向と手続き型をサポート: オブジェクト指向と手続き型の 2 つの開発スタイルをサポートし、下位互換性があります。
内蔵 Zend 加速エンジン、安定した高速パフォーマンス。
PHP5の新機能
· コンストラクターとデコンストラクター。
·オブジェクトへの参照。
·オブジェクトのクローン。
· オブジェクトのプライベート、パブリック、保護モード。
·インターフェース。
·抽象クラス。
·__電話。
·__set と __get。
·静的メンバー。
Windows での AppServ 組み合わせパッケージの使用
組み合わせパッケージは、Apache、PHP、MySQL などのサーバー ソフトウェアとツールをパッケージ化したものです。それらはインストールされています。開発者は、構成済みのパッケージをローカル ハード ドライブに解凍するだけで、追加の構成を行わずに使用できます。組み合わせパッケージにより、PHP開発環境を迅速に構築できます。 PHP の学習を始めたばかりのプログラマーは、この方法で PHP 開発環境を構築することをお勧めします。組み合わせパッケージは柔軟性に劣りますが、インストールが簡単で、高速かつ安定しているため、初心者により適しています。
インターネット上には人気のある組み合わせパッケージが多数あります。ここでは、EasyPHP、AppServ、XAMPP の 3 つの推奨組み合わせパッケージを紹介します。初心者の場合は、EasyPHP または AppServ を使用することをお勧めしますが、XAMPP はより複雑です。
クリックして AppServ パッケージをダウンロードします:
以下に示すように:
AppSer 統合インストール パッケージの構築
1. AppServ ファイルをダブルクリックして、以下に示す起動ページを開きます。2. [次へ] ボタンをクリックします。以下に示すように、AppServ インストール同意ページが開きます:
3. [同意する] ボタンをクリックして、以下に示すページを開きます。このページでは、AppServ のインストール パスを設定できます (デフォルトのインストール パスは通常 c:AppServ です)。AppServ のインストールが完了すると、Apache、MySQL、および PHP がサブディレクトリの形式でこのディレクトリに保存されます。
4、[次へ]ボタンをクリックして以下に示すページを開き、インストールするプログラムとコンポーネントを選択できます(デフォルトではすべて選択されています):
5. [次へ]ボタンをクリックして開きます以下に示すページ。主に Apache ポート番号を設定します。
Apache ポート番号の設定は非常に重要であり、Apache サーバーが正常に起動できるかどうかに直接関係します。このマシンのポート 80 が IIS または Thunder によって占有されている場合、ここでポート 80 がまだ使用されているとサーバー構成を完了できません。この問題は、ここでポート番号を変更するか、IIS または Thunder のポート番号を変更することで解決できます。 6. 次の図に示すように、[次へ] ボタンをクリックして開きます。このページでは、主に MySQL データベースのログイン パスワードと文字セットを設定します。ここでは、文字セットはに設定されています。 GB2312 簡体字中国語」。MySQL データベースを表す文字セットは、簡体字中国語形式になります:
7。以下に示すように、[インストール] ボタンをクリックしてインストールを開始します: 8。次の図は、インストール完了後のインターフェイス: AppServ をインストールすると、デフォルトでディレクトリ全体が「c:AppServ」パスの下にインストールされます。このディレクトリにはいくつかのサブディレクトリが含まれます: ブラウザを開いて「」と入力します。 http://localhost/[ポート番号を設定しました。80 の場合は入力する必要はありません]。次の図が開くと、AppServ が正常にインストールされたことを意味します: PHPの開発に伴い、数多くの優れた開発ツールが登場しました。自分に合ったツールを見つけると、学習の進捗が速くなるだけでなく、将来の開発プロセスの問題を迅速に発見し、寄り道を避けることができます。私たちが選択した開発ツールは Dreamweaver です。プロジェクト作成の詳細については、オンライン情報を参照してください。関連おすすめ:
PHP開発キットphp7 php環境構築PHP入門から習熟まで以上がPHP環境構築チュートリアル - 詳細なグラフィックとテキストの説明の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。